About the Role
As part of the Capital Management Americas team, you will support Treasury in the region; implementing the target capital structure for all Business Units and supporting the regional CFOs and business teams on all treasury related topics. You will experience exposure to a variety of business topics, ranging from Reinsurance to Primary business, from Life & Health lines to Property & Casualty lines across the US, Canada and Latin America. Treasury work encompasses both the asset and liability side of the balance sheet in our ongoing pursuit of optimizing financial resources.

About the Team
Capital Management team is within Group Treasury. We are responsible for capital and liquidity management, as well as asset-liability management and the Finance transaction review process across the Swiss Re Group. We are organized into three regional capital management teams based in Zurich for EMEA, Armonk for the Americas, and Singapore for Asia, as well as 2 central teams based in Zurich mainly responsible for asset-liability management and group capital steering. We are flexible in structuring our tasks and frequently work together on initiatives across teams. We constantly strive to improve our understanding of value creation in the context of Swiss Re and to use this knowledge to increase our effectiveness.
